    The last 5 visits have been concerning. I grew up going to this location and you would know the staff by name and they would consistently keep good help. The last 3 years I've noticed a huge decline and no one stays anymore. This one server we had twice but she was terrible and we have tried to explain things to management and they brushed it off. Also the app sucks and we couldn't get the app to work to redeem a free desert. Well after being embarrassed trying to get it to work we were about to give up and just pay, one of the associates finally just said to take it off for us. I mean it's just a place I try to avoid and I hate that.

    Generally they serve a pretty good breakfast. Lately they seem to be struggling with their menu and quality. This morning what are usually some of the best pancakes had an off flavor. Sort of like they picked up another flavor off an unclean griddle. The eggs and sausage were both cold.

    Let me tell you why I love stopping at Cracker Barrel! There's a familiarity like an old friend. Selena was our sever and was quick to take our drink orders as soon as we sat down. The food came in a reasonable amount of time for it being dinner time. When the kitchen forgot to put the diced tomatoes and green onions on the Biscuit Benny Benedict, and a spoon for my grits, Selena was quick to remedy it. I love the sense of teamwork here, too. Our server was busy, and Dan came to check on us and refilled my coffee, got a travel cup, and got us our ticket so we could get back on the road. (Still had a couple hours to drive and wanted to get going). He was so kind and helpful. On our way out Kayla smiled so sweetly and wished us a good night and thanked us for coming. This is why I love Cracker Barrel.They hire friendly folks. (food with the ratings on pics)

    Public at the Brickyard was one of the highlights of our time in Wichita. After spending the day…read moreexploring Tanganyika Wildlife Park, we wanted a relaxing dinner within walking distance of our hotel, and this locally owned restaurant was exactly what we were hoping to find. The first surprise was the size of the restaurant. From the street, it looks fairly modest, but once inside, it opens into a beautiful historic warehouse with exposed brick, an industrial feel, and a lively atmosphere. I also loved discovering the large outdoor patio tucked away behind the building--it would be a fantastic place to enjoy live music on a future visit. We ordered the baby back ribs, which had just been introduced to the menu that evening, and they were incredible. The meat was tender enough to fall right off the bone, the baked beans had just the right amount of spice, and the fries rounded out a great comfort meal. I also enjoyed trying a local cider on tap, and we couldn't resist finishing with the Key Lime Pie Crème Brûlée, which was absolutely delicious. What really stood out was how relaxed the experience felt. Even though the restaurant was busy, we never felt rushed. The staff was friendly, the atmosphere was welcoming, and it was the perfect place to unwind after a full day of adventure. If you're visiting Wichita, especially if you're staying in Historic Old Town, I highly recommend adding Public at the Brickyard to your itinerary. Great food, genuine hospitality, and a wonderful example of supporting local Kansas producers make this a restaurant I'll gladly return to on my next visit.
